
So, it was time to start on my 1815 British. The plan was to have enough units to field the British army for the Waterloo campaign, with each unit representing a brigade in Bloody Big Battles. This force required a bit of a mix of different figures. The British regulars needed to be ordered from the Gajo 1812 line. The light infantry, highlanders and rifles came from the Gajo Napoleonic line.


I needed to adjust the trousers on the earlier uniformed models and change them from white to gray. I left the officer pans white though. I could not get the mix of facings that I wanted, so I repainted some of these to get all the units I wanted.


All the flags were from GMB and affixed with white glue. Like all my other troops, these were mounted to white metal bases. All flocked with Woodlands Scenics flock attached with Geohex Green. Once that was all dry, I sprayed down the whole lot with Tamiya dull coat. I did see that the red in the flags ran a bit (*&^&). I will have to reorder that step on future models, when I have red in the flags…. Anyway, that gives me all the British brigades for the Waterloo campaign.
